The Parkway, my main route to work, was jammed yesterday. Fortunately, I can bail and take an alternate route to get to my place of employment--and so I did. 

I was excited that I made the traffic light, which is incredibly long at the first intersection after departing the Parkway--and the next intersection is a right turn and so not usually any delay there, but shortly I came across a definite stoppage of traffic--geese crossing the roadway in Hanover, MD.

It is clear why I enjoy taking this alternate route to work, as there is no traffic in sight. There was a car stopped next to me as we both waited for the family of geese to cross the roadway. They were taking their time and despite that I was in my usual hurry to get to work, I actually enjoyed the stoppage to watch these birds cross the roadway oblivious to the danger that was paused waiting for them to complete their journey.

I made it to work, but I was glad that I had enjoyed a brush with nature to start my day.
